Responsibilities
- Lead the field staff and deploy the project strategy.
- Create, update and maintain an accurate project schedule which includes all aspects of scheduling (phasing, logistics, etc.) and that encompasses all phases and key milestones from pre-construction to turnover.
- Research and address owner and building rules and regulations, permit procedures and any other requirements, and ensure Trinity’s compliance.
- Supervise all field operations ensuring that the work is being done in accordance with the project strategy and construction documents, and that Subcontractor performance and quality of work meet Trinity’s standards for customer satisfaction.
- Perform daily site walk-throughs to monitor construction progress, quality control and site safety.
- Adhere to and promote Trinity’s safety policies and procedures in order to maintain a clean, safe jobsite.
- Maintain positive relationships with subcontractors and vendors; treat them fairly and professionally in all interactions and set an example for others to do the same.
- Develop a complete punch list and ensure its timely, thorough execution; obtain sign-off from client.
- Inspire, coach and mentor assigned field staff members.
